MSCP_BUFFER is a system parameter that specifies the number of pagelets to be allocated to the MSCP server's local buffer area on Alpha and Integrity servers.

This buffer area is the space used by the server to transfer data between client systems and local disks.

MSCP_BUFFER is an AUTOGEN and FEEDBACK parameter.
